LIHEAP energy assistance application

Use this when a household needs help with heating, cooling, or a utility crisis. Dates and account numbers matter here.

Missouri Family Support Division
  • Utility account number and current bill
  • Disconnect or crisis notice if there is one
  • Household income details
  • Landlord or fuel vendor information if applicable

Report changes for SNAP

Use this when income, household, address, or other SNAP details changed. Report dates and proof matter because benefits can be affected.

Missouri Family Support Division
  • What changed
  • Date the change happened
  • Proof if available
  • Current case or notice information

How to use the form links

Open the official page first, read the current instructions, then use any available PDF or online application link from that agency page. If a PDF opens in the browser, download it before filling if the browser does not save typed answers reliably.

What not to send online

Do not send passwords, full Social Security numbers, bank details, or private medical records through the OpenACAI contact form. If sensitive documents are needed, ask for a safer support path first.
